Updating Results

BP Malaysia

  • 1,000 - 50,000 employees

2022 Digital Graduate - Digital Engineering Programme null

Kuala Lumpur, Federal Territory of Kuala Lumpur, Malaysia

Opportunity Expired

As a Service Engineer, you will be embedded within a dynamic engineering-focused team, learning about new platform products and services.

Opportunity details

Opportunity Type
Graduate Job

Application dates

Minimum requirements

Accepting International Applications
No
Qualifications Accepted
E
Electrical & Electronic Engineering
Engineering & Mathematics (all other)
Mathematics & Statistics
I
Computer Science (all other)
Computer Systems and Networks
Programming & Software Engineering

Hiring criteria

Degree in computer science, computer engineering, management information systems, electrical/electronic engineering or maths

See details

Working rights

Malaysia

  • Malaysian Temporary Work Visa
  • Malaysian Citizen
  • Malaysian Permanent Resident
Read more

About this opportunity

Our purpose is reimagining energy for people and our planet. Our ambition is to be a net zero company by 2050 or sooner. We want to be an energy company with purpose; one that is trusted by society, valued by shareholders, and motivating for everyone who works at bp. We’re building an IT organization that can drive our business ambitions, by being first into markets and delivering efficiencies through automation, machine learning and artificial intelligence. We are building a culture of success and providing our IT professionals the opportunities to grow and embrace the technologies to deliver our ambitions.

About the roles

Service, Software & Platform engineering underpins all that we do. It enables our business aspirations and helps turn our net zero ambitions into a reality. As a graduate, you will help shape the future of bp.

As a Service Engineer, you will be embedded within a dynamic engineering-focused team, learning about new platform products and services. You will execute operational support activities according to documented service procedures and work instructions and help your team to deliver service improvements that maximize operational efficiency

As a Software Engineer, you will be embedded within one of our software engineering teams and will learn the approaches and techniques to deliver business value. You will be exposed to new technologies and learn to develop new solutions and products. You’ll be developing enterprise software primarily using Java J2EE / C#.Net or other high-level languages. Learn about low-code platforms such as Salesforce, Service Now and Microsoft PowerApps. You will be exposed to responsive mobile/web application development using React Native / Xamarin or other modern frameworks.

As a Platform Engineer, you will be embedded within one of our platform engineering teams and will learn the approaches and techniques to deliver high value, highly scalable and resilient platforms to support the enterprise. You will be exposed to new technologies and learn to build, maintain, and administer platforms across the enterprise. You will learn about our automation frameworks and will have the opportunity to develop your complex scripting (typically Python) skills and support microservices development.

Requirements

Analytical and logical, you’ll be keen on software development and looking to learn and collaborate among our skilled software developers.

  • To apply to this role you'll need a 2:1 degree, or equivalent, in computer science, computer engineering, management information systems, electrical/electronic engineering or Maths. 
  • You’ll also need to be in your final year of study or have completed your degree. 
  • A confirmed grasp of development fundamentals (in high-level languages such a C#/Java/Python/R) with desire and eagerness to learn more. Getting the basic's right will be key to your advancement in the field and will be the foundation through grow.
  • An understanding of modern development methodologies (Agile using Scrum and/or Kanban) with real-world experience in automations using Python or other high-level languages.

As this is a technical role if you are successful in progressing to the on-demand video interview stage a short coding test will follow the interview. Your responses to the coding test will be reviewed alongside the other elements of the assessment process; the test is not pass or fail.

Diversity sits at the heart of our company and as an equal opportunity employer, we stay true to our mission by ensuring that our place can be anyone's place. We do not discriminate based on race, religion, colour, national origin, gender identity, sexual orientation, age, marital status, veteran status or disability status.

Application Process

  • Online application 
  • Online tests
  • Video interview 
  • Technical interview
  • Assessment center
  • Offer and feedback

Hiring criteria

You should have or be completing the following to apply for this opportunity.

Degree in computer science, computer engineering, management information systems, electrical/electronic engineering or maths
Degree or Certificate
Minimum Level of Study
Bachelor or higher
Study Field
E
Electrical & Electronic Engineering
Engineering & Mathematics (all other)
Mathematics & Statistics
I
Computer Science (all other)
Computer Systems and Networks
Programming & Software Engineering

Work rights

The opportunity is available to applicants in any of the following categories.

country
eligibility

Malaysia

Malaysia

Malaysian Temporary Work Visa

Malaysian Citizen

Malaysian Permanent Resident